Vitamin B12 shots are typically given intramuscularlymeaning the injection is delivered directly into a muscle, most often in the upper arm (deltoid), thigh, or buttock
Conditions such as Crohns disease or Celiac disease can inflame the gut lining, making it difficult for the small intestine to absorb B12 efficiently
Potential Side Effects While Vitamin B12 injections are generally safe, some people may experience mild side effects, including: Pain or redness at the injection site Mild diarrhea Itching or rash Headache Dizziness Severe allergic reactions are rare but require immediate medical attention
